Importance of Liverpool in the Modern Context

Liverpool, a vibrant port city in northwest England, has long stood as a cultural and economic hub. Known for its rich maritime history, the city gained international acclaim as the birthplace of The Beatles and the site of the historic Liverpool Football Club. The significance of Liverpool extends beyond its entertainment and sports, as it plays a vital role in the UK’s economy, tourism, and cultural diversity.
